Output 6d8666ef766c41e0e53b57b04e14c428a6a1ff309b857762f87644d0c5a976fc:1

value
1220414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375ad9fba1945a0f0a5d748a2bd186a7c03d8 OP_EQUAL
address
3BMEXZVpP1ekB2pY1ze8WnVpKewRJgm4Ae
transaction
6d8666ef766c41e0e53b57b04e14c428a6a1ff309b857762f87644d0c5a976fc
spent
true